Raman–Hyperspectral Microscopy
A modular platform combining dark-field scattering hyperspectral imaging, fluorescence, and optional Raman spectroscopy with fast push-broom data-cube acquisition.

Optical Tweezers Microrheology
A complete optical tweezers platform for microrheology and single-particle tracking — trapping micron-scale beads to probe the viscoelastic properties of soft matter and biological samples.

Confocal Raman Microscope
A high-resolution confocal Raman microscope for chemical mapping and material analysis, combining diffraction-limited spatial resolution with high-throughput spectral acquisition.

Nobel Prize-winning 3D Super-Resolution
The SPINDLE® bypass modules and engineered Phase Mask technology, converting standard microscopes into 3D super-resolution single-molecule localization platforms.

Mount Adapters, Targets & Cages
Adapters for standard microscope ports, high-contrast resolution targets (USAF 1951), alignment guides, and optical cage interfaces.

Reconstruction & Localization Suites
Advanced software packages for single-molecule 3D tracking, super-resolution reconstruction, PSF calibration, and drift correction.
